Beregovaia TV, Khomenko TA, Gubkin VA: [The effect of histamine H1 receptors on the secretory function and blood flow in the gastric mucosa]. Farmakol Toksikol. 1990 Jan-Feb;53(1):41-3. In chronic experiments on dogs with the gastric fistulas it was shown that H1-histamine blockers (suprastin, peritol, pipolphen) fail to enhance histamine secretion and a selective H1-agonist IEM-813 fails to suppress it. It was also found that the ability of pipolphen to suppress the gastric secretion was due to its cholinolytic properties. |
